i am 15 can i volunteer anywhere?
Reply 1
You'll be more limited but I know that you can volunteer for Girlguiding UK at 15 (and so probably Scouts too). Some charity shops take on 15 year olds.

I'm afraid most companies aren't willing to allow a 15 year old to volunteer due to the fact they consider anyone under the age of 18 a liability.

You might be able to volunteer at a local animal shelter, nursing home or charity shop but I'd say that'd be about it.

Maybe try this website?

https://do-it.org/

But again, I say. Perhaps wait till you're at least 16?

Yeah I'm sure you can! I volunteered at kids groups at church from the age of 14, at at 15 I volunteered on my first summer camp. And people your age do Bronze DofE which requires a volunteering section, so if others have done it I'm sure you too can find somewhere; Actually, I'm pretty sure that somewhere on the DofE website you can search volunteering places in your local area if you are stuck for ideas of cannot find anywhere.
